Output 6616723ac123a5c998a4a8c7c4b3066ce9da0b62f5d4530862ada0c7fd9cc4a1:0

value
97859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 128cda566d07e9966cd637bc51c5fe297bb39cd5 OP_EQUAL
address
33P6pdHfvh3woXPepx62KmdxqWR5hpzR6r
transaction
6616723ac123a5c998a4a8c7c4b3066ce9da0b62f5d4530862ada0c7fd9cc4a1